We love nature here at Scandle.  St. Patrick’s Day makes us think of the Shamrock, known as a symbol of Ireland3

Fun Facts about Clovers
  • The highest known number of leaves on a clover is 56, according to the Guinness Book of World Records. This was found in Japan in 2009.4    That is a LOT of leaves!
  • Legend says that each leaf of the clover means something: the first is for hope, the second for faith, the third for love and the fourth for luck.5
